📜 The Lost History – The Void Century
There’s a 100-year gap in the world’s history books called the Void Century.
Who erased it? Why is the World Government so afraid of people learning the truth?
We know the Ancient Kingdom fought the ancestors of today’s Celestial Dragons. They left behind Poneglyphs—massive stone blocks that hold the truth.
Nico Robin can read them, which is why the Government hunts her. But one day, the Straw Hats will uncover the full story.

⚔️ The Ancient Weapons
The Ancient Weapons are powerful enough to destroy the world. Three are named:
Weapon | Power | Current Status |
Pluton | A battleship that can sink islands | Said to be in Wano |
Poseidon | Control of Sea Kings | Princess Shirahoshi |
Uranus | Unknown | Still a mystery |
Why were these weapons made? Will Luffy’s crew ever use them? Or will they fall into the wrong hands?

🌀 Devil Fruits
Devil Fruits are the coolest mystery in One Piece. They give powers that break all rules—fire fists, rubber bodies, even turning into animals!
But where do they come from? No one knows. Some say they’re gifts from the sea, others think they’re ancient science.
When a user dies, the fruit’s power is reborn in another fruit nearby. How does that even happen? And why can’t anyone eat two—except for Blackbeard?
The Government even hid the truth about Luffy’s fruit, renaming it to cover its real power.
Vegapunk gave us hints, but even the smartest scientist doesn’t have all the answers.

🔥 Mysterious Characters
Some people in One Piece are mysteries in themselves.
Gol D. Roger discovered the truth of the world, yet said he was “too early.” Why? And what disease killed him?
Rocks D. Xebec once ruled the seas with future Emperors under him, but his name was erased. Could he still be alive?
Blackbeard breaks every rule. He doesn’t sleep, has multiple personalities, and somehow ate two Devil Fruits. What is he?
Shanks is beloved, yet he secretly spoke with the Gorosei. Why would the world’s most trusted pirate meet the world’s rulers?
And then there’s Dragon, Luffy’s father—the most wanted man alive. What power does he hide? Why did he rebel?
Even Zoro carries a secret. His connection to Ryuma and the Shimotsuki family hints at a hidden legacy yet to be revealed.
🌌 The Moon and Beyond
Yes, even the moon has mysteries!
Enel, the lightning man, went there and found ruins of an ancient civilization.
Did the ancestors of the people on Earth come from space? Were Devil Fruits connected to them?
The carvings on the moon show ships leaving for Earth. That means the true story of One Piece might even be cosmic!
